ANECDOTE

Origin of Street Bucket Drumming

  • Questlove and Tariq started busking on South Street playing drums on buckets and freestyling to earn money.
  • They earned around $110 in four hours, enabling them to enjoy date nights and continue performing weekly.
ANECDOTE

Building Credibility in Philly

  • The Roots gained underground hip hop credibility by playing live shows in Philadelphia's diverse venues, including coffee shops and clubs.
  • Their live instrument approach won respect from audiences who normally rejected rap music at the time.
INSIGHT

Live Instruments vs. Sampling

  • Performing live with real instruments gave The Roots artistic credibility beyond typical rap groups.
  • Their musical style challenged the prevailing norms of using samples and helped set them apart in hip hop.
